We know that the car with rear wheel drive has less maximum acceleration than maximum deceleration. The reason is this: since the drive wheels are in the rear, away from the engine, the normal force on the drive wheels is decreased (compared to the wheels being in the front) and there is less acceleration. On the other hand, when brakes are applied, all four wheels are used and thus a huge amount of friction is provided.
